Are there harmful ingredients in food coloring that affects plants?

0
10

Many food colors come from plants and therefore should not effect them. Some are manufactured, but they are tested to see that they do not harm people, so should not harm plants. Some people and animals are allergic to the colors, and there is some research into effects of food colors on behavior in children, especially hyperactivity.
